Yellow streaks in the toilet: how to get rid of them
The yellow streaks that appear on toilets are mainly caused by limescale deposits. These do not look pleasant and make the toilet appear dirty and unclean. One of the most effective methods is to use two ingredients from the kitchen. These are baking soda and vinegar.
